Agartala: July 27: The Kalyanpur Scouts and Guides unit’s disaster management team has been praised for their courageous efforts in rescuing a dog from a nearly 40-foot deep abandoned pit in the Shikarai Bari area of Dakshin Ghilatal, under the Kalyanpur police station jurisdiction.

The incident came to light when concerned citizens noticed the dog trapped in the pit and promptly informed the Khowai district administration. The administration quickly alerted the Kalyanpur Scouts and Guides unit’s disaster management team, who arrived at the scene and initiated the rescue operation.

After nearly two hours of continuous effort, the team successfully rescued the dog unharmed, showcasing their exceptional skills and dedication. Local residents have expressed their gratitude for the team’s bravery and commitment to saving the helpless animal.

Scout Master and Master Trainer in Disaster Management, Abhijit Acharya, commented on the incident, stating that the team’s successful rescue was a result of the extensive training they receive to handle various types of disasters. He emphasized that the knowledge and skills gained from this training enabled the team to save the dog from a life-threatening situation.
